The Actual List: Bingo Calls 1 to 90 (The Standard UK Version)
Here is the thing. There are dozens of variations of these calls. Some clubs use old army slang, others use pop culture. But the core uk bingo calling numbers list is pretty standard. I have played in halls from Manchester to London, and this is the set that sticks.
- 1 – Kelly’s Eye
- 2 – One Little Duck
- 3 – Cup of Tea
- 4 – Knock at the Door
- 5 – Man Alive
- 6 – Half a Dozen
- 7 – Lucky Seven
- 8 – Garden Gate
- 9 – Doctor’s Orders
- 10 – Downing Street
- 11 – Legs Eleven
- 12 – One Dozen
- 13 – Unlucky for Some
- 14 – Valentine’s Day
- 15 – Rugby Team
- 16 – Sweet Sixteen
- 17 – Dancing Queen
- 18 – Coming of Age
- 19 – Goodbye Teens
- 20 – One Score
- 21 – Key of the Door
- 22 – Two Little Ducks
- 23 – Thee and Me
- 24 – Two Dozen
- 25 – Duck and Dive
- 26 – Half a Crown
- 27 – Gateway to Heaven
- 28 – Overweight
- 29 – Rise and Shine
- 30 – Dirty Gertie
- 31 – Get Up and Run
- 32 – Buckle My Shoe
- 33 – All the Threes
- 34 – Ask for More
- 35 – Jump and Jive
- 36 – Three Dozen
- 37 – More than Eleven
- 38 – Christmas Cake
- 39 – 39 Steps
- 40 – Life Begins
- 41 – Time for Fun
- 42 – Winnie the Pooh
- 43 – Down on Your Knees
- 44 – Droopy Drawers
- 45 – Halfway There
- 46 – Up to Tricks
- 47 – Four and Seven
- 48 – Four Dozen
- 49 – PC
- 50 – Half a Century
- 51 – Sweet and Twenty
- 52 – Chrome Dome
- 53 – Here Comes Herbie
- 54 – Clean the Floor
- 55 – Snakes Alive
- 56 – Was She Worth It?
- 57 – Heinz Varieties
- 58 – Make Them Wait
- 59 – Brighton Line
- 60 – Five Dozen
- 61 – Bakers Bun
- 62 – Turn the Screw
- 63 – Tickle Me
- 64 – Red Raw
- 65 – Old Age Pension
- 66 – Clickety Click
- 67 – Stairway to Heaven
- 68 – Saving Grace
- 69 – Favourite
- 70 – Three Score and Ten
- 71 – Bang on the Drum
- 72 – Six Dozen
- 73 – Queen Bee
- 74 – Hit the Floor
- 75 – Strive and Strive
- 76 – Trombones
- 77 – Sunset Strip
- 78 – Heaven’s Gate
- 79 – One More Time
- 80 – Eight and Blank
- 81 – Fat Lady with a Walking Stick
- 82 – Straight on Through
- 83 – Time for Tea
- 84 – Seven Dozen
- 85 – Staying Alive
- 86 – Between the Sticks
- 87 – Torquay in Devon
- 88 – Two Fat Ladies
- 89 – Almost There
- 90 – Top of the Shop

FAQ: Common Questions About UK Bingo Calls
Why is number 2 called “One Little Duck”?
Because the number 2 looks like a swan or a duck swimming. It is one of the oldest calls in the book. The shape of the digit is the key.
Is there a difference between 90-ball and 75-ball bingo calls?
Yes. 75-ball bingo uses letters (B, I, N, G, O) and has different patterns. The bingo calling numbers 1 to 90 uk complete guide is specifically for the 90-ball variant, which is the standard in the UK. 75-ball is more American.
